There are 5 ways to get from Sorso to Alghero by train, bus, rideshare, car, or taxi
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train
best- Take the train from Sorso to Sassaritrain Sassari-Sorso
- Take the train from Sassari to Algherotrain Sassari-Alghero
1h 57m€3–6Bus
- Take the bus from Sorso Fronte Biblioteca to Sassari Via Padre Ziranobus Linea 721 / ...
- Take the bus from Sassari Via Padre Zirano to Alghero Via Catalognabus Linea 9323 / ...
2h 28m€4–7Rideshare
- Take the rideshare from Sorso to Alghero44.6 km
1h 3m€3Drive 45.8 km
- Drive from Sorso to Algherocar 45.8 km
39 min€7–11Taxi
- Take the taxi from Sorso to Algherotaxi 45.8 km
39 min€95–120
Sorso to Alghero by train
Questions & Answers
The cheapest way to get from Sorso to Alghero is to rideshare which costs €3 and takes 1h 3m.
The fastest way to get from Sorso to Alghero is to drive which takes 39 min and costs €7 - €11.
No, there is no direct bus from Sorso to Alghero. However, there are services departing from Sorso Fronte Biblioteca and arriving at Alghero Via Catalogna via Sassari Via Padre Zirano. The journey, including transfers, takes approximately 2h 28m.
No, there is no direct train from Sorso to Alghero. However, there are services departing from Sorso and arriving at Alghero via Sassari. The journey, including transfers, takes approximately 1h 57m.
The distance between Sorso and Alghero is 41 km. The road distance is 45.8 km.
The best way to get from Sorso to Alghero without a car is to train which takes 1h 57m and costs €3 - €6.
It takes approximately 1h 57m to get from Sorso to Alghero, including transfers.
Sorso to Alghero bus services, operated by ARST Spa - Trasporti Regionali Della Sardegna, depart from Sorso Fronte Biblioteca station.
Sorso to Alghero train services, operated by ARST Spa - Trasporti Regionali Della Sardegna, depart from Sorso station.
The best way to get from Sorso to Alghero is to train which takes 1h 57m and costs €3 - €6. Alternatively, you can bus, which costs €4 - €7 and takes 2h 28m.
What companies run services between Sorso, Italy and Alghero, Italy?
You can take a train from Sorso to Alghero via Sassari in around 1h 57m. Alternatively, you can take a bus from Sorso Fronte Biblioteca to Alghero Via Catalogna via Sassari Via Padre Zirano in around 2h 28m.
- Phone
- +39 351 8374226
- information@arst.sardegna.it
- Website
- arst.sardegna.it
Train from Sorso to Sassari
- Ave. Duration
- 15 min
- Frequency
- Hourly
- Estimated price
- €1–2
- Schedules at
- app.arstspa.it
Train from Sassari to Alghero
- Ave. Duration
- 42 min
- Frequency
- Every 2 hours
- Estimated price
- €2–4
- Schedules at
- app.arstspa.it
- Phone
- +39 351 8374226
- information@arst.sardegna.it
- Website
- arst.sardegna.it
Bus from Sorso Fronte Biblioteca to Sassari Via Padre Zirano
- Ave. Duration
- 28 min
- Frequency
- Every 2 hours
- Estimated price
- €1–2
- Schedules at
- app.arstspa.it
Bus from Sassari Via Padre Zirano to Alghero Via Catalogna
- Ave. Duration
- 1h
- Frequency
- Every 3 hours
- Estimated price
- €3–5
- Schedules at
- app.arstspa.it
- Phone
- +3 318 576 2228
- Website
- blablacar.com
Rideshare from Sorso to Alghero
- Ave. Duration
- 1h 3m
- Frequency
- 3 times a day
- Estimated price
- €3
- Schedules at
- blablacar.com
- Ave. Duration
- 39 min
- Estimated price
- €95–120
Turris Travel NCC
- Phone
- +39 345 9712165
- Website
- turristravel.it
Taxi Baraghini
- Phone
- +39 3475707974
- Website
- taxibaraghini.it
Fresi Taxi Sassari
- Phone
- +39 320 792 7774
- Website
- fresitaxi.it
CTS Radia Taxi Sassari
- Phone
- +39 079 253939
- Website
- sassaritaxi.it
Want to know more about travelling around Italy
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Italy Travel Guides
Read the travel guide
More Questions & Answers
Sorso to Alghero bus services, operated by ARST Spa - Trasporti Regionali Della Sardegna, arrive at Sassari Via Padre Zirano station.
Sorso to Alghero train services, operated by ARST Spa - Trasporti Regionali Della Sardegna, arrive at Sassari station.
Yes, the driving distance between Sorso to Alghero is 46 km. It takes approximately 39 min to drive from Sorso to Alghero.
There are 1822+ hotels available in Alghero.
Check out Blablacar's carpooling service for rideshare options between Sorso and Alghero. A great option if you don't have a driver's licence or want to avoid public transport.



